ABSTRACT:
An ultrasonic transducer apparatus of variable frequency including a diffracting structure adapted for emitting and receiving a plurality of diffracted ultrasonic beams of calculable different angles for determining the velocity of a fluid flowing through a lumen, and flow volume. Velocity and flow volume are determined from at least two equations in the two unknowns of the velocity, and the angle between the ultrasonic transducer apparatus and the direction of the fluid flow, and from a determination of the diameter of the lumen.
